Output 57c847e1045aec0ed361ef872dfa7c74d3b6ed463d05a665ad985ba7fd406b5d:12

value
109209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b46b7cf8a6a79563e046f2f4610ac442881131 OP_EQUAL
address
3Mza4vUfrYH5ju4U63corHLhqp1grFupJ8
transaction
57c847e1045aec0ed361ef872dfa7c74d3b6ed463d05a665ad985ba7fd406b5d
confirmations
262572
spent
true